The Knights hit the road for the final time of the regular season when they make the trip to to Quinnipiac and Princeton. The Knights are tied for 4th with Dartmouth in the ECAC standings and will need to out pace the Big Breen as they do not own the tie break.
Quinnipiac has wrapped up the ECAC Regular Season title, and sits 7th in the national pairwise. The Knights have lost their last 3 to the Bobcats, but all have been close games. The last win for Clarkson was Feb 12th of 2022. The Knights have been struggling with some sickness
and injuries, but will get some players back this weekend.
Ayrton Martino leads the team in assists with 16 and total points with 24.
Ryan Taylor, despite missing several games with injuries, leads the team in goals scored with 10.
Trey Taylor is the leader from the blueline with 3 goals, 13 assists, and a +16 rating. Taylor also leads the team in shot attempts (79) and blocked shots (59).
Austin Roden has been strong down the stretch, holding teams to 2.4 goals against in February.
Clarkson will be looking to stay in the top 4 of the ECAC and earn a first round bye. To do so, the Knights will need any combination of points that out paces Dartmouth in the final two games, while also staying ahead of Union and SLU. Union is 2 points back of the Knights and SLU sits 4 points back. Harvard could catch the Knights in points but Clarkson owns the tie break.
